No Mercy send early message to summer league, in thumping of MFA 4.0

Wednesday, June 23rd, 2010 by Dr Hoopz

No Mercy – 107

MFA 4.0 – 54

No Mercy send early message to summer league, in thumping of MFA 4.0

The comment read in short ‘hold me’ and No Mercy responded with one of the most lopsided victories in recent Hoopz history. No Mercy held the anonymous Blues Man and the entire squad of MFA 4.0 to a sub-par game of the ages winning 107 – 54 in the weekend finale.

Gene Shepherd was all smiles prior to tip-off and much more after the game.

The only one smiling on the Free Agents organization was the General Manager, who says, “this will only makes us better in the long run against the elites and teams like the Warriors.â€

Another GM agreed by saying, “games like this do not happen often but a team is bound to get their faces handed to them when they manage ZERO team assists.â€

The Men’s Free Agents 4.0 did as much on the assist end as Staurt Scott on a Wednesday morning.

Dion Currie, middle, played big finishing with a double-double in Sunday’s action

All but one No Mercy player scored in double digits in this thumping of the ages.

No Mercy was led by Dion Currie 22 points, 14 rebounds and 4 assists in the victory.

MFA 4.0 were missing their post dominance in Jared Mast. The presence of Mast would have made a difference given that the best player for the Agents was six foot Sean Davis.

Davis had a strong performance finishing with 33 points, 3 rebounds and 3 assists. Numbers similar to a previous Free Agent, now champion, Gene Shepherd.

Shepherd is one of a kind and so was Davis this game against No Mercy. Many more nights Davis offensive skill will be a necessity for the Agents, as Davis will likely see double and triple teams.

Similar to last season watch out ‘the beast’ Shepherd is hungry for more gold cups, any challengers?
